What Should I Expect When I'm at HighPoint?

At HighPoint Fellowship, we feel that it's OUR responsibility to "clear the way" for you to come to church. We want you to be able to experience the great music, encouraging messages, friendly people and enjoyable atmosphere that are a part of HighPoint. And we know that your first time at a church, any church, brings up some questions. How do I get there... what should I wear... what's available for my kids... what should I expect in church? Here is a quick look at what you can expect.

OFFERING - Each week we take up an offering to support the church. The offering is for those who are part of the HighPoint family. As our guest, you don't need to participate in the offering at all. Instead of wanting you to give something, we want you to get something!

"CHURCH CLOTHES" - No tie? No problem! HighPoint folks come as they are, some a little fancy, most decidedly not. We're more concerned with meeting your real life needs than with what you wear.
